West Nile in New Mexico (KVII 7 Amarillo)
Friday, July 18, 2008 at 3:19 p.m. In New Mexico, health officials have confirmed the first case of equine west nile virus. The State Health Department says a horse from McKinley County tested positive.

8:14 p.m. Arkansas Man Drowns in New Mexico (KARK Little Rock)
An Arkansas man has been found dead in New Mexico... Police in Santa Fe, New Mexico tell us that 57-year-old Robert Casey drowned Monday night. Casey is originally from Heber Springs, but was living in Santa Fe.
